My first bath

The pediatrician had warned us that some babies love baths and others hate them. She also let us know that full-fledged baths are rarely necessary with little babies, since they don't crawl around in the dirt and get dirty. Clearly, she had no understanding of the array of bodily fluids that Zack douses himself in daily. So, we went for the real deal immersion bath, not just the sponge bath (he's had those). Like the books said, I got all of the supplies laid out in the bathroom, and we filled the little infant tub we'd bought for this purpose.

Zack turned out to be one of the babies who don't care for the bath. He cried the whole time, the kind of crying where his face is all bunched up and his whole body turns red with anger. It was a short bath. In the end, I handed him off the Nathan, who knelt down in our bathtub and rinsed him thoroughly under the faucet. (The bathwater had gotten all soapy and rinsing wasn't so effective). In any case, after MUCH drama, we have a squeaky clean and great smelling baby boy. He also tired himself out fussing like that so he's having a long nap right now. Right after the bath, we diapered him and swaddled him in blankets and I got in bed with him and let him fall asleep on me, under the covers, to warm up and calm down. We both like that.

I even used baby shampoo on his hair. He really does smell great, but then he was born smelling great. He smelled like baby powder, naturally. Did they make baby powder smell the way it does to imitate the natural smell of newborns?
